Verification and anti-fraud policy
Everyone on the platform is identified — workers and employers alike. This page says exactly what is checked, what is never shared, and what gets an account suspended.
What is checked, on both sides
- Workers: identity document, guided selfie matched against it, age 18 or over
- Companies: registration documents, INN, and that the signatory can act for the company
- Private employers: identity document, same check as workers
The check is automatic first. When the document is unreadable, the selfie does not match or anything looks altered, an operator reviews it by hand within two hours.
What is never shared
The document itself never leaves the verification system. Employers see a badge, not a scan. Support agents handling a dispute see the check-ins and the messages, not the document.
What gets an account suspended
- Using someone else\u2019s account, or sending someone else to a shift
- Altered or borrowed documents
- Arranging payment outside the platform, from either side
- Repeated no-shows without notice
- Listings that hide the real work, the real place or the real pay
Why paying outside the platform is a bad idea
It is the single most common way people lose money here. Outside the platform there is no held amount, no recorded hours and no dispute route — and both accounts are suspended when it is discovered, which costs the employer their verified workers and the worker their rating.
Reporting something
Report from the listing, from the shift chat, or at abuse@geteasywork.com. Reports about safety on site are handled the same day.
